Federal Trade Commission v. Equifax Inc.
Plaintiff: Federal Trade Commission
Defendant: Equifax Inc.
Case Number: 1:2019cv03297
Filed: July 22, 2019
Court: US District Court for the Northern District of Georgia
Presiding Judge: Thomas W Thrash
Nature of Suit: Other Statutory Actions
Cause of Action: 15 U.S.C. § 0053
Jury Demanded By: None

July 22, 2019 Filing 9 Minute Entry for proceedings held before Judge Thomas W. Thrash, Jr.: MOTION HEARING held on 7/22/2019 re Counsel's request to preliminarily approve the proposed class action settlement and Plaintiffs' (739 in 1:17-md-02800-TWT) Motion for Order to Direct Notice of Proposed Settlement to the Class. The Court preliminarily approved the proposed class action settlement and ordered notice be given to the class members. The Court approved the proposed notice plan and settlement administration process. Final approval hearing scheduled for December 19th, 2019 at 10:00 a.m. (Associated Cases: 1:17-md-02800-TWT, 1:19-cv-03297-TWT, 1:19-cv-03300-TWT) (Court Reporter Diane Peede) (EQCCtrk) (sap)
